6 votes

Step-by-step explanation

Given


3^(2x)+4=31

We can find the value of x below.


\begin{gathered} 3^(2x)+4=31 \\ subtract\text{ 4 from both sides} \\ 3^(2x)-4+4=31-4 \\ 3^(2x)=27 \\ 3^(2x)=3^3 \\ 2x=3 \\ divide\text{ both sides by 2} \\ x=(3)/(2) \\ x=1.5 \end{gathered}

Answer: 1.5
